Description
The book does a great job on the How. It explains well how Nushell works. But it lacks a bit on the Why. The Introduction hints on it but it seems to get lost on the surface, e.g. "modern style of development", "modern feel", "UX polish". New users tend to want to know the Why first before the How.
The Philosophy section of the Contributor Book does a great job on the Why. But it's usually read only long after the How and only by people interested in the underlying details.
I'd like to propose moving the Why before the How. This means moving the Philosophy section into the main book before any concrete "Usage" sections. It would probably make sense to put it just after the Installation section.
